Frequently Asked Questions about Seabrook Hills
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Seabrook Hills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Seabrook Hills ranges from $725 to $1,605 with an average monthly rent of $1,110.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Seabrook Hills c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Seabrook Hills range from $850 to $1,795.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,334.
How expensive are Seabrook Hills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Seabrook Hills on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,300 to $3,145 - averaging $1,842 for the location.
